3091436
0x6b691a3a613a6f07019263134a1a59b25189517e750ed2ed77b951650d5d10d4
Transactions0
Height3091436
Confirmations13198746
Timestamp1109 days 7 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x30cd9825057474b7
Bits
Difficulty0xcadd6a9